Bio1: annual mean temperature; Bio2: mean diurnal range (mean of monthly (max temp–min temp)); Bio3: isothermality (Bio2/Bio7) (× 100); Bio4: temperature seasonality (standard deviation × 100); Bio5: max temperature of warmest month; Bio6: min temperature of coldest month; Bio7: temperature annual range (Bio5–Bio6); Bio8: mean temperature of wettest quarter; Bio9: mean temperature of driest quarter; Bio10: mean temperature of warmest quarter; Bio11: mean temperature of coldest quarter; Bio12: annual precipitation; Bio13: precipitation of wettest month; Bio14: precipitation of driest month; Bio15: precipitation seasonality (coefficient of variation); Bio16: precipitation of wettest quarter; Bio17: precipitation of driest quarter; Bio18: precipitation of warmest quarter; Bio19: precipitation of coldest quarter
